About the job

Job description

Key Responsibilities
* Assessment of safety cases drawing conclusions as a subject matter expert on the adequacy of the demonstration, raising issues, or considering future inspection work. Human Factors topic discipline involvement includes assessment of risk assessment of HF aspects of major hazard risk identification and risk control; design of interfaces, control systems, control rooms and other safety critical equipment and management systems relating to ensuring reliable human behaviour.
* Investigations of incidents or complaints as a Human Factors topic specialist in a multi-disciplinary investigation team dealing with evidence gathering, enforcement, prosecutions and supporting others as necessary on technical aspects.
* Preparation of technical reports / expert evidence for various levels of legal proceedings.
* Inspections (both onshore and offshore) as part of a multi-discipline team, to identify risk and underlying issues and make judgements about the adequacy of control measures, completing reports and issuing different levels of enforcement depending on the risk present.
* Provision of expert advice on health and safety matters associated with Human Factors within Energy Division, HSE, industry and other relevant stakeholders.

Travel and Working Patterns

This is a full-time role and, you will be required to spend periods of time offshore, including overnight stays, approximately 6 - 8 times a year.

You will travel from Aberdeen by helicopter or marine access to offshore installations, and floating production and non-production installations, for anything from one to four days at a time and will spend on average 2 to 3-night stays offshore (subject to weather), all within a small multi-discipline team.

When not working offshore or on site, your office attendance would be in accordance with HSE's Hybrid Working Policy.

Regular travel to Aberdeen and other HSE offices for training and meetings will also be required and this can require overnight stays.
